Planteneers Presents Clean-Label System for Plant-Based Ice Creams at ISM Ingredients
Planteneers, a producer of custom system solutions for plant-based alternatives, has announced it will be presenting a functional system for the production of frozen desserts at ISM Ingredients in Cologne.
Called fiildDairy IC 171001, the system is said to combine “creamy enjoyment, clean-label, and nutritional added value”. It enables the creation of dairy-free ice creams that reportedly deliver an authentic dairy-like texture with no need for additives or flavorings.
Made from plant fiber and chickpea protein, the premix can be used to produce a variety of plant-based desserts, including ice creams, frozen yogurt, and frappé products. The system is plant-based, vegan, halal, and kosher-certified, with a twelve-month shelf life. It is claimed to have simple “plug-and-play” usability on all standard production lines, enabling fast integration into existing processes.
“Plant-based alone is often no longer enough”
The new system can also be used to produce reduced-sugar or reduced-calorie ice creams containing plant fiber for added nutritional value, reportedly without sacrificing creaminess, overrun, or melt properties. The solution offers significant flexibility for many different market segments and target groups.
To use the premix, manufacturers only need to combine it with water, sugar, and fat, before moving on to the next stage of their conventional production process. If desired, products can be made oil-free, for example by using nut
pastes.
“Plant-based alone is often no longer enough; products must meet additional criteria,” Dr. Matthias Moser, Managing Director of the Food Ingredients Division of the Stern-Wywiol Group, told vegconomist in a recent interview. “They need to have a certain protein content, they have to contain fiber, etc. These higher quality demands are reflected in ingredients lists as well as in the taste – and that’s the decisive factor. Products have to taste good, otherwise they simply don’t have a future.”
